Recently, Global Infrastructure Solutions Inc. (GISI), the parent company of The LiRo Group and Hill International, Inc., consolidated a portion of the highly experienced staff of both LiRo and Hill in the Northeast to create a larger, more efficient, and cost-effective team to serve our clients. LiRo-Hill is now a 1,100-person firm with offices in NYC, Long Island, Buffalo, Rochester, Boston and Edison, NJ.
Responsibilities
- Management project teams and multiple direct reports
- Work with Sr. Program Manager and Principle in Charge to access client capital programs
- Develop win plans and work with Client Account Managers to align strategic plans and business goals
- Ensures timely and quality completion of project work within budget
- Communicates directly with clients and maintains strong business relationships
- Provides technical evaluations, advice, and guidance in areas of expertise
- Collaborates with technical leaders and other business units to supplement expertise and provide clients with wholistic and innovative solutions
- Manage construction projects as well as contractor compliance with project documents
- Assess impact of change requests or delays on the project schedule and budget
- Ensure compliance with the project specific construction and/or project management plans
Qualifications
- Minimum 15 years of successful construction and project management combined experience with emphasis in transit/rail projects
- 5 years minimum management experience of a project team and/or direct reports
- Bachelor’s degree in construction management or engineering
- PE, CCM or PMP required
- Strong communication skills at multiple project levels ranging from trades to executives
- Provide leadership in all areas of scheduling, safety, and quality
- Ability to work under tight deadlines and handle multiple tasks
